‘Undo Send’ Extension For Gmail

Have you ever sent and email and then realized a second later that you forgot an attachment or didn’t include some information? We all have. To help with this problem, Gmail has introduced a new add-in from their Labs section appropriately named ‘Undo Send’:

Oops, hit “Send” too soon? Give yourself a grace period of a few seconds to cancel sending, then edit your message before sending again.

To add this to your Gmail account, click on the Settings link and then go to the Labs tab. Scroll down until you find the ‘Undo Send’ option and enable it. Once you do this, after you send a message you will see an undo link above your inbox for a few seconds which lets you recall the message you just sent.
